1. Export as PDF through Save As
Feature entry: Top menu bar > More > Save As
- Open the spreadsheet that you want to convert.
- Tap More on the top menu bar.
- Select Save As, then choose a save location.
- Change the file format to PDF spreadsheet.
- Tap Export as PDF and wait for the conversion to finish.
Success Criteria
- On-screen result: The app finishes the conversion and creates a PDF file.
- What you can do next: You can open the PDF from the saved location or continue sharing it.
Tips While Using
- Common mistake: If you do not choose a save location or switch the format to PDF first, the file may still be saved in its original format.
- Environment note: Large files may take longer to convert.
2. Export as PDF through Share
Feature entry: Top menu bar > Share > Share as PDF
- Open the target spreadsheet.
- Tap Share on the top menu bar.
- Select Share as PDF.
- Choose Original or Image-only PDF and wait for the conversion to finish.
- Choose the target app or recipient and send the file.
Success Criteria
- On-screen result: The app creates a PDF file that is ready to share.
- What you can do next: You can send it through chat apps, email, or other receiving apps.
Tips While Using
- Common mistake: Leaving the page before the conversion finishes may interrupt sharing.
- Permissions or membership: Some functions in this flow may depend on membership.
- Environment note: Sharing usually requires network access and permission for the target app.
3. Export as PDF through Convert
Feature entry: Top menu bar > More > Export to PDF
- Open the spreadsheet that you want to convert.
- Tap More on the top menu bar.
- Select Export to PDF.
- Choose Original or Image-only PDF and wait for the conversion to finish.
- Choose a save location and save the file.
Success Criteria
- On-screen result: A PDF file is generated after the conversion finishes.
- What you can do next: You can open, send, or archive the file.
Tips While Using
- Common mistake: Choosing the wrong output mode may affect how the file is viewed later.
- Permissions or membership: Some functions in this flow may depend on membership.
4. Export as PDF through Scan
Feature entry: WPS home screen > Bottom menu bar > Scan > To PDF
- On the WPS home screen, tap Scan on the bottom menu bar.
- Select To PDF.
- Choose File or Photo Scan.
- Wait for recognition and conversion to finish.
- Choose a save location and save the PDF file.
Success Criteria
- On-screen result: The scanned content is organized into a PDF file.
- What you can do next: You can view, send, or archive the file locally.
Tips While Using
- Common mistake: If the captured image is unclear, the exported result may be harder to read.
- Permissions or membership: This feature requires membership.
- Environment note: Photo scanning requires camera permission, and online recognition scenarios work better with a stable network connection.
